Villgro is an Indian incubator for early-stage social enterprises. It was founded in 2001 and works from IIT Madras Research Park in Chennai, with a second office in Bengaluru.

Fostering Innovation: Sustainable Mobility Challenge is Villgro’s call for startups solving problems in sustainable mobility, with the stated aim of making cities more livable. Villgro names four focus areas: access to transport, fleet optimisation, road safety, and EV infrastructure and electric mobility.

Selected startups receive financial support, technology and business mentorship, customised incubation, and introductions for pilot partnerships. Villgro lists the challenge as running from 2022 and marks applications as closed. No further round has been announced.

Benefits & funding

  • Financial support for selected startups. Villgro publishes no amount for this challenge.
  • Villgro incubation funding is given as equity, debt, a grant, or a combination of these.
  • Technology and business mentorship.
  • Customised incubation, which Villgro describes as subsidised mentoring, specialist technical services, a diagnostic panel with industry experts, a 100-day plan with milestones, weekly calls and field visits.
  • Networking and partnerships to run pilots.
  • Later-stage help with market channel development and with raising commercial capital.

Eligibility

  • Technology startups creating impact in the mobility sector.
  • The company is at minimum viable product (MVP) or prototype stage.
  • The solution fits one of the four focus areas: access to transport, fleet optimisation, road safety, or EV infrastructure and electric mobility.
  • No nationality, residency, age, degree or work-experience requirement is published.
  • Villgro runs its incubation from India, and applications go through its India-based incubation portal.

Application process

  1. 1
    Check the status on the program page. Villgro currently marks applications as closed.
  2. 2
    When a round is open, apply through the link published on that page.
  3. 3
    Outside an open round, use the Apply for Incubation button, which opens Villgro’s incubation application portal.
  4. 4
    Villgro assesses applicants and convenes a diagnostic panel with industry experts before signing an incubation agreement.
  5. 5
    Onboarded enterprises agree growth milestones and go through a compliance gap review.
